Our team of IT Technical Support Officers forms part of the IT Infrastructure department that oversees the company's IT network, servers and security systems whilst ensuring business continuity is maintained.
Responsibilities:
Installing and configuring computer hardware operating systems and applications;
Monitoring and maintaining computer systems and networks;
Talking staff or clients through a series of actions, either face-to-face or over the telephone, to help set up systems or resolve issues;
Troubleshooting system and network problems and diagnosing and solving hardware or software faults;
Replacing parts as required;
Providing support, including procedural documentation and relevant reports;
Following diagrams and written instructions to repair a fault or set up a system;
Supporting the roll-out of new applications;
Setting up new users' accounts and profiles and dealing with password issues;
Responding within agreed time limits to call-outs;
Working continuously on a task until completion (or referral to third parties, if appropriate);
Prioritizing and managing many open cases at one time;
Rapidly establishing a good working relationship with staff and other professionals, such as software developers;
Testing and evaluating new technology;
Qualifications & Experience:
The minimum level of education is diploma level, preferably in a related field such as MCAST-BTEC Diploma in IT or its equivalent;
1 years’ work experience.
